Scott Bowman Obituary

Scott M. Bowman, 39, died Monday, September 25, 2006, at home following a lengthy illness. He was the husband of Dawn M. (Shearer) Bowman. Together they celebrated 11 years of marriage on August 28, 2006. Born February 4, 1967, in York, he was the son of Bette L. (Mundis) and Carney Bowman, Sr. of York. Scott was a graduate of York County Vocational Technical School and attended CityView Community Church. He loved to cook and played junior golf. He was a devoted husband and father and loved his family. In addition to his wife and parents, he is survived by two daughters, Natalie M. and Micah L. Bowman, both at home; brothers, Carney Bowman, Jr., Steven B. Bowman, a twin brotherm Christopher R. Bowman, and Robbie D. Bowmanm all of York; sister, Melissa A. Bowman of York; nieces and nephews; and a great-niece and great-nephew. A funeral service will be held Friday at 11 a.m. at Etzweiler Funeral Home and Cremation Service, 1111 E. Market St., York, with Pastor Joseph R. Kopp of CityView Community Church officiating. Burial will be in Prospect Hill Cemetery. A viewing will be held Friday from 10 to 11 a.m. at the funeral home. In lieu of flowers, contributions may be made to Scott's family at 318 Hawthorne St., York, PA 17404. www.etzweiler.com
